How much does a jump start cost in Southside?
A jump start in Southside starts at $60+, with after-hours calls between 10pm and 6am adding a set surcharge. If the battery won't hold a charge after the jump, we'll tell you honestly rather than just leaving.
What if my car won't start again after a jump in Southside?
That usually means the battery itself is dead, not just low, or there's a different electrical issue. We test it on the spot in Southside and tell you what we find, and can arrange a tow if the car needs a shop visit.
Do you carry jump-start equipment for all vehicle types in Southside?
Yes, standard 12-volt jump packs handle cars, trucks, and SUVs. Hybrid and EV batteries work differently, tell dispatch what you're driving in Southside so we bring the right equipment.
